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) is a direct farm-to-customer business model.  Members pay for a season’s worth of produce or meats (a membership) in advance and receive a “share” of fresh produce, meat, eggs, or flowers through the harvesting season. This is great for the farmers because they get the revenue when they most need it to get ready for the growing season.
